Q: Is 102,531,032 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 102,531,032 is not a prime number.

Why is 102,531,032 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 102531032 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 487 974 1,948 3,896 26,317 52,634 105,268 210,536 12,816,379 25,632,758 51,265,516 and 102,531,032, with no remainder.

Since 102,531,032 cannot be divided by just 1 and 102,531,032, it is not a prime number.
